JF - British Journal of General Practice JO - Br J Gen Pract SP - 301 LP - 301 DO - 10.3399/bjgp11X567333 VL - 61 IS - 585 AU - David Carvel Y1 - 2011/04/01 UR - http://bjgp.org/content/61/585/301.abstract N2 - Every weekday lunchtime I have a scheduled telephone surgery. It sends the practice's phone bill skywards, but we accept most such calls nowadays are to mobiles as people are busy (or like to appear busy!). Despite this, up to a third of these consultations fail to take place. This is partly because one of our receptionists has a rather annoying habit of being one random digit out, in the given eleven. Other reasons we're told, include: batteries running low; bosses demanding they be switched off; or because our rolling southern Scottish landscape still has many ‘blind spots.’I therefore find myself each day listening to a robot curtly telling me to leave a message … ER -
